That looks like one of the common, more-offsetted alloy 2-piece Taiwan posts from the 1990's.

That's considered vintage by many sellers now, even if they want you to believe it's old and rare.

I would be semi-surprised of there weren't a mfg date stamped on the shaft down where the size is also stamped in.

My guess is it's a Kalloy variant, I've had a couple of these.

Taking a look in back, I have 2 just like it: dated "KI" (K1?) and "G 92", but not actually branded. So early 1990's it is.
